Wing Hop Fung

Wing Hop Fung, located at 725 W Garvey Ave, Monterey Park, CA 91754, United States, is a renowned herbal medicine store known for its extensive collection of high-quality herbs, teas, and wine. Established in 1972, the store has been dedicated to providing authentic Chinese products to its customers.

The store offers a wide range of specializations, including herbal medicine, herb shop, tea store, and wine store. They provide various onsite services, such as delivery and same-day delivery, ensuring that customers can receive their products promptly. Additionally, the store is wheelchair accessible, with both a wheelchair-accessible entrance and parking lot, making it convenient for all visitors.

With a 4.3 out of 5 average opinion rating based on 410 reviews on Google My Business, Wing Hop Fung has garnered a strong reputation for its quality products and exceptional customer service. Customers praise the store's knowledgeable staff and impressive product selection, which ranges from high-end to affordable options. Many reviewers have also mentioned the excellent packaging and authentic taste of the teas available at the store.

Wing Hop Fung accepts various payment methods, including credit cards, debit cards, and NFC mobile payments, making it convenient for customers to shop at the store.

Overall, Wing Hop Fung is a top-notch herbal medicine store that offers a diverse range of products and exceptional services. Its commitment to quality and customer satisfaction has earned it a loyal following and a well-deserved high rating on Google My Business.

This is the place to get all your Chinese herbs and delicacies. Wing Hop Fung is such a trustworthy brand for quality imports. They have a huge variety of Chinese goods and they import directly from sources in China that they’ve been doing business with for many, many years. WHF is such an established business in the market. It’s also family owned and operated.

Their tea selection is my favorite part of the store. You’re allowed to open the tops off the glass jars to experience the aromas of the teas. If you want a sample, simply let the employees know. They may not all speak English, but they are friendly, and they know how to understand what you want. You can purchase teas in bulk, let the staff know about how much (quantity like quarter pound or cash value, either work) and they will weigh your tea on a scale. They have all sorts of Chinese, Japanese and Indian teas. Special blossoming flowers, a huge selection of Pu-Erhs, and a whole corner of the store is dedicated to herbs. These herbs are not your typical garden herbs. They carry Goji berries, all sorts of dried mushrooms, ginseng and medicinal roots. It’s like candy land for herb enthusiasts.

On top of their enormous tea variety, they have a huge inventory of alcohol. Some bottles of cognac are the only variety available in the U.S. WHF carries select and exclusive liquors. It’s an impressive collection, and they often host wine/liquor/sake tasting events for you to sample their lineup.

Get tea sets, incense, soaps and beauty products here too! The parking is free out front.
